Sustained release profiles and targeted delivery of pharmaceutical products

A matrix tablet is coated with functional polymers, followed by a blend of hydrophilic and hydrophobic polymers. Layered erosion and diffusion of the drug matrix tablet result in a controllable release. An effective solution for targeted drug delivery through customized and sustained release technology. Assists development of high-dosage and sustained release products for once-daily administration.

Customized release profiles, including zero-order release

This technology incorporates a blend of hydrophilic polymers that control drug release via diffusion through, and erosion of, a matrix tablet. Some layers contain drug substance; others are rate controlling polymers.

Key Benefits

  • Matrix tablet utilizes a combination of water soluble particles and active drug
  • Suitable for high drug loading
  • Supports sustained release, once a day dosing
